- Ratepayer Protection Commitment: The Trump administration has signed a voluntary agreement with major tech companies to build or purchase the electricity needed for rapidly expanding data centers, covering the infrastructure costs to connect to the grid, thereby alleviating consumer electricity burdens.
- Surge in Electricity Demand: The U.S. brought online a record 10 gigawatts of new data center capacity in 2025, with electricity demand increasing by 2.8% year-over-year, marking the fastest growth rate in nearly 20 years, highlighting the significant impact of AI infrastructure expansion on the power market.
- Lack of Enforcement Power: Despite the agreement, experts indicate that the pledge lacks legal force, as state regulators ultimately decide on electricity pricing structures, meaning the White House cannot enforce new policies.
- Positive Industry Response: Companies like Amazon and Microsoft have indicated they will cover the costs of their expanding electricity needs, reflecting the industry's recognition of public concerns regarding potential increases in household electricity costs due to AI infrastructure.

- Custom Silicon Strategy: Meta plans to expand its custom silicon applications from simple recommendation algorithms to complex AI model training, aiming to enhance performance and efficiency while reducing reliance on third-party suppliers like Nvidia and AMD.
- Personalized Workloads: CFO Susan Li noted that some of Meta's workloads are highly customized, particularly those related to AI models and personalized recommendations, indicating that tailored hardware will better meet its unique needs.
- AI Training Chip Testing: Testing for Meta's first in-house AI training chip is expected to begin in early 2025, and despite setbacks with advanced designs like Olympus in February, the company aims for a 2026 rollout for generative AI.
- Alignment with Industry Trends: This initiative aligns with broader industry trends to optimize AI infrastructure costs and performance, signaling Meta's pursuit of a competitive edge in the rapidly evolving AI landscape.
- Surge in AI Revenue: Broadcom reported a more than 100% year-over-year increase in AI revenue for Q1, reaching $8.4 billion, demonstrating the company's robust performance amid the AI boom, which is expected to drive sustained future growth.
- Strong Earnings Guidance: The company achieved a 29% increase in total sales to $19.3 billion in Q1, surpassing analyst expectations, with CEO Hock Tan projecting AI semiconductor revenue of $10.2 billion for the current quarter, further solidifying its market leadership.
- Rising Customer Demand: As large customers increasingly require custom silicon, Broadcom has secured the supply chain necessary to meet its 2027 sales targets, indicating strategic readiness to fulfill market demands.
- Key Customer Collaborations: Broadcom is assisting six major clients, including Google, Meta, Anthropic, and OpenAI, in chip design, which is expected to accelerate the next phase of custom AI deployment and further drive company growth.
